The Sarava Estate and Villa Saminiati
Eleonore, Fabien, and their daughter Ida moved to Lucca in Tuscany in 2021 where they purchased the Sarava estate. Villa Saminiati was built in 1623 and features 10 hectares and 1200 olive oil trees.
The estate also includes:
o A 17th century palazzo with farms (currently under renovation)
o A 17th century palazzo with farms (currently under renovation)
o Stables from the 19th century
o 2 organic vegetable gardens
o 1 organic orchard with 160 trees, cultivating 57 varieties of fruits
o Several olive oil facilities which include an olive oil laboratory and state-
of-the-art storage tanks
